College of Saint Benedict vs South Dakota State University (SDSU)
College of Saint Benedict (CSB) and South Dakota State University (SDSU) stand as distinct institutions of higher learning, each offering unique opportunities and experiences to their students. CSB, a private, women's liberal arts college, boasts a tight-knit community and a focus on personalized education, while SDSU, a public, land-grant research university, offers a wide range of academic programs and a vibrant campus life. With varying acceptance rates, popular majors, student body demographics, and graduation rates, these universities cater to different student profiles and aspirations.
